Warnings
WARNING
THERMAL EXPANSION HAZARD
Fluids subje
cted to heat in confined spaces, including hoses, can create a rapid rise in pressure
due to the the
rmal expansion. Over-pressurization can result in equipment rupture and serious
injury.
Open a valve to relieve the fluid expansion during heating.
Replace hos
es proactively at regular intervals based on your operating conditions.
PRESSURIZED ALUMINUM PARTS HAZARD
Use of flui
ds that are incompatible with aluminum in pressurized equipment can cause serious
chemica
l reaction and equipment rupture. Failure to follow this warning can result in death,
serious
injury, or property damage.
Do not use 1,1,1-trichloroethane, methylene chloride, other halogenated hydrocarbon
solvents or fluids containing such solvents.
•Manyot
her fluids may contain chemicals that can react with aluminum. Contact your material
suppli
er for compatibility.
PLASTIC PARTS CLEANING SOLVENT HAZARD
Many s
olvents can degrade plastic parts and cause them to fail, which could cause serious
injur
y or property damage.
Use only compatible water-based solvents to clean plastic structural or pressure-containing
parts.
•SeeT
echnical Data in this and all other equipment instruction manuals. Read fluid and
solv
ent manufacturer’s MSDSs and recommendations.
